How many managers, mobility teams, or legal teams have been faced with the question ‘Do I need a visa?’.


Business travel is undoubtedly common across all areas and levels of your business. Increasingly, a focus on cost reduction and dual income families means that companies are also expanding the use of extended business travel where previously they may have offered a short term or long term assignments.

However, these rarely have the same focus and robust pre-approval processes as more structured assignments, and may bypass proper planning for immigration.

Fill out the form to learn more!

Download Factsheet